the way 19th century thinkers use the word "scientific" is very different from the way we use it. nietzsche's goals didn't reside in the scientific method or in proving anything or even falsifying things. the value systems he created around will to power were, as you say, personal intuitions, and while they are supported by arguments they aren't meant to be taken dogmatically or as fact. part of the idea is that values can't be imparted in any other way, there's no proof for them
